Canva, CapCut and Premiere Pro: The Perfect Social Media Editing Suite
Want to increase your social media game? You need the right editing tools. That's where CapCut, Canva, and Premiere Pro come in. These platforms/apps/programs offer a range of capabilities to help you create stunning content that will grab attention.
From simple visuals in Canva to professional edits in Premiere Pro, there's something for every level of designer.
Here's a quick look at what each software can do:
* **Canva:** Perfect for those new to editing, Canva offers a user-friendly interface with thousands of designs to choose from. Easily design eye-catching graphics for Instagram, Facebook, and more.
* **CapCut:** This mobile software is ideal for video editing. With a range of transitions, you can transform your videos to stand out.
* **Premiere Pro:** For the professional editor, Premiere Pro offers industry-standard tools for complex post-production.
No matter your creative goals, there's a tool in this trio to help you achieve success on social media.
